Add 56/20 and 6/54

1st number: 2 16/20, 2nd number: 6/54

56/20 + 6/54 is 131/45.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 20 and 54 is 540

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 540
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 20 × 27 = 540,
    56/20 = 56 × 27/20 × 27 = 1512/540
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 54 × 10 = 540,
    6/54 = 6 × 10/54 × 10 = 60/540
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    1512/540 + 60/540 = 1512 + 60/540 = 1572/540
  5. 1572/540 simplified gives 131/45
  6. So, 56/20 + 6/54 = 131/45
